UOL: Milan target Otavio makes a decision regarding his future

Otavio, AC Milan's target, who is currently playing for Porto, is a Brazilian attacking midfielder, 26 years old, capable of occupying other roles on the pitch like being a winger.

The player is under an expiring contract which ends in June 30, 2021. Naturally, there are teams interested in securing his services like AC Milan as per many reports have suggested.

There have also been reports claiming that Brazilian side Palmeiras are interested in signing the player on a free.

However, according to the latest news from uol.com.br Otavio would not be willing to move away from Europe to join the Brazilian giants and Copa Libertadores champion.

The same source confirms Milan's interest in the player. Therefore, Palmeiras being out of the race, who are trying to compete for Otavio, would only be a boost to AC Milan's chances to land the player.
